Marti Marmaris – Marmaris

The Marti Marmaris marina is situated on the blue seas of Turkey's southern coast, bordered by pine trees and home of the archaeological ruins of the Goddess Hemithea. It is 25 kilometres away from Marmaris, a beautiful city worth discovering.

The marina itself is a modern development with exclusive yachting and sailing facilities. It has a berthing capacity of 300 on the water and 100 on land, with the servicing, comfort and security facilities you would expect. Managed by the Marti Hotel Group, staff have 30 years of experience behind them.

The marina has been awarded the prestigious blue flag award, which means it has achieved the highest standards of cleanliness and maintenance. Only 14 of Turkey's marinas have attained this level. The water is exceptionally clean and offers very pleasant conditions.

Marti Marmaris offers a range of boat services, including mast stepping and unstepping, underwater inspections and battery charging, as well as interior cleaning, bilge washing, polishing wax and antifouling paint. Diesel and petrol are both available and water and electricity are free. An extensive range of technical services are provided upon request and dry-docking and hauling is possible for vessels fit for a 60 tonne travel lift.

The slight distance between the marina and the main city means Marti Marmaris is particularly tranquil. Away from the hustle and bustle you can relax in hammocks under the trees along the bay or sit near the shore knowing that marina staff are taking care of you.

Next to the marina, you'll find the Mistral Restaurant & Bar which specialises in Mediterranean and Far Eastern cuisine. Here you can dine in the lavishly decorated interior, enjoy a meal under the stars, or breakfast in the sun by the restaurant's pool. The restaurant offers a ten per cent discount to marina guests. Alternatively, the Wheelhouse Cafe is another friendly option.

A supermarket is on site which caters for all your needs, as well as a laundry service and tourist trips can also be arranged at the reception. High standard toilet and shower facilities are always open. However, should you need to get in contact with the world beyond, internet facilities are available at the reception 24 hours a day and getting to Marmaris is easy via the free shuttle service provided by the marina. The post office is situated on the main square and Marmaris also offers some stunning views as the city is built on one of the largest natural harbours in the world. The spot is held to be the meeting point of the Aegean and Mediterranean Sea.

Nearby places of interest are recommended by the marina and are well worth a trip. Kizkumu, for example, has a stunning lagoon or you can visit the waterfall near Turgut, which is hidden in the shade of sycamore trees.
